Crime overview

Ryton Crescent area has the 21st lowest crime rate of 53 local areas in Dawdon , and the 753rd highest crime rate of 1,720 local areas in County Durham .

Neighbouring streets tend to have noticeably higher crime levels than this postcode. Crime here is lower than the average for the surrounding output areas.

The overall crime rate in the area around Ryton Crescent (SR7 8BN) in the last 12 months was 93.2 per 1,000 residents and was 35.8% lower than the Dawdon average (145.0 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Criminal damage and arson with 14 offences recorded. The least common crime was Anti-social behaviour with 1 case , unchanged from 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Drugs ( 50.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Other crime ( -50.0% YoY).

Violent crimes totalled 11 (≈ 34.2 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 22.2%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-86.9% comparing early vs recent averages) .

In the area around Ryton Crescent (SR7 8BN),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Queensbury Road, where police recorded 160 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Ryton Crescent (14 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
